AttilaTheMeerkat · 25/05/2020 12:49

Temp charting with PCOS is problematic and really not worth doing. It just causes the problems you describe and you end up with a chart akin to the Rocky Mountains. Apart from anything else most gynaes do not take any notice of such charts precisely because they are so unreliable.
